zoukankan      html  css  js  c++  java
  • hive集群安装

    本文介绍hive-1.2.2的安装,生产环境多使用CDH、HDP构建集群,搭建此集群主要用于学习。

    1.下载解压

    在官网下载hive-1.2.2的安装包,上传到linux服务器,并解压到/usr/local目录

    2.安装mysql数据库

    hive默认将元数据保存在内存数据库中,重启后数据会丢失,所以将元数据保存到mysql比较好。

    安装过程请自行百度。

    3.修改配置文件

    打开hive-1.2.2目录

    vi conf/hive-site.xml,加入如下配置

    <configuration>
    <property>
    <name>javax.jdo.option.ConnectionURL</name>
    <value>jdbc:mysql://hdp-01:3306/hive?createDatabaseIfNotExist=true</value>
    <description>JDBC connect string for a JDBC metastore</description>
    </property>

    <property>
    <name>javax.jdo.option.ConnectionDriverName</name>
    <value>com.mysql.jdbc.Driver</value>
    <description>Driver class name for a JDBC metastore</description>
    </property>

    <!-- 数据库用户名,根据自己的数据库用户名填写 -->

    <property>
    <name>javax.jdo.option.ConnectionUserName</name>
    <value>root</value>
    <description>username to use against metastore database</description>
    </property>

    <!-- 数据库密码,根据自己的数据库密码填写 -->

    <property>
    <name>javax.jdo.option.ConnectionPassword</name>
    <value>wym123</value>
    <description>password to use against metastore database</description>
    </property>
    </configuration>

    4.上传jar包

    上传一个mysql connector的jar包到hive的安装目录的lib 

    5、配置环境变量

    配置HADOOP_HOME HIVE_HOME到系统环境变量中:/etc/profile

    然后使变量生效 source /etc/profile

    6、hive启动测试

    输入指令hive,启动hive

    至此,hive 安装成功,相关教程将在后续更新。

      

  • 相关阅读:
    防抖与节流
    两台电脑互联
    es6标签模板转义html
    vue[mini-css-extract-plugin]Conflicting order between 警告解决方式(转载)
    如何解决Windows10处于通知模式(转载)
    hexo与github page搭建博客
    缓动类型参考
    微信代扣-免密支付 开通教程
    Linux服务器安全配置
    在linux (centos)上使用puppeteer实现网页截图
  • 原文地址:https://www.cnblogs.com/RingWu/p/10079721.html
Copyright © 2011-2022 走看看